Tools still needed for playground April 18, 2008 Tools continue to be needed for the community playground project, which gets underway next Wednesday.
The borrowed items will be labeled, kept under lock and key and not allowed off the work site. They may be brought to the city of Antigo fire department Saturday from 10 a.m. to noon.
Tools needed include drills, heavy duty extension cords, 9/16 inch wrenches, screwdrivers, wood rasps, metal rakes and shovels, pick axes, wheelbarrows, six to 12 foot ladders, safety glasses, 16 ounce hammers, 36 inch levels, routers, orbital jig saws, tables and electric lead cords.
“This is one of the biggest things to happen in Antigo in a while,” organizer Chris Matousek said. “It is the start of a positive movement in the downtown area.”
